  10. D

    Dgabriel's Swing Journal

    I posting a few charts of stocks that have high RS vs. the SP500 for 1 year and that painted bullish hammers today. The idea is that the weak hands were forced out during the selloff of the last few days, resulting in a short term capitulation folowed by a either vigorous short covering/ new...
